刚刚学习Vue,使用Vue-cli生成的项目,怎么配置服务器数据的访问?

如题,用vue-cli init webpack [项目名], 我们都知道浏览器有跨域访问限制,使用npm run dev运行起来的服务是没有服务器代码支持的!这个问题怎么破?是要解决webpack的配置么?大家是怎么使用vue来开发的?

阅读 17.3k
5 个回答

@g0ne150 的办法应该算是一种解决方案。目前,我是自己修改了webpack的配置文件,使用watch方式将所有文件都编译到指定文件。

对于vue-cli配置代理无效的问题,我也遇到了,不过,按照vue-templates模板指定设置

配置完成后,需要将本地localhost的域名改下,也就是修改HOSTS文件,将127.0.0.1给一个自定义的域名(必须与访问服务器的域名后半部分相同如服务端域名为www.baidu.com,你定义的本地域名为xxx.baidu.com),这样就可以在本地通过代理拿到服务端的数据了

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题